The UFC has had a lot of enemies since its creation in 1993. Pillow Fighting Championship (PFC) and its CEO Steve Williams are the most recent to join that list.
The beef between the two organizations stems from a trademark dispute. According to The New York Post, the UFC objected to the PFC’s trademark application because the logo’s red color could lead to confusion with the UFC’s logo.
Williams has opted to change the color of the PFC logo to avoid a battle with the UFC. In that sense, the UFC was victorious in this beef. Nonetheless, Williams had some choice words for the organization and its president Dana White.
Williams provided The New York Post with comments on the trademark dispute with the UFC.
“It’s ridiculous. Out of the 100 million comments nobody ever said anything about being confused,” Williams said.
Williams was also bullish on the idea of having a pillow fight against White.
“Yes I’d definitely like to get Dana in the ring,” he said. “He’s a decade younger and spent his entire life around MMA fighters but I’m 100% sure that I’d stomp his skinny a** in the first round.”

Regardless, Williams is optimistic that the UFC and PFC can coexist in the combat sports landscape.
“PFC is a great gateway sport for children and is also a great on and off-ramp for past, present and future UFC Champions, so we can coexist perfectly,” he said.
The PFC has actually had a couple of UFC fighters take part in a pillow fight. UFC women’s strawweight Istela Nunes was the promotion’s first female champion and former featherweight Marcus Brimage fought in the organization.
